As suggested, now we have Smart ABC's attention (not an easy thing to do when you are a struggling franchisee), we should have a meeting. After all, one of Smart's broken promises in our contracts was to have an anual network meeting with all franchisees invited. I really can't say I'm suprised they never had one, the last thing Smart wants is all those people they deceived coming together under one roof. Then they wouldn't be able to tell you that you are the only one failing, and everyone else is doing brilliantly. Smart should invite all current Franchisee's along as well as the ex-franchisee's. To kick-off, I'd like to see the following items on the Agenda:


 


1 - Smart MD's son-in-law and ex-Technical Director and now Franchisee (albeit with a much bigger area than other franchisee's are allocated)to demonstrate to us all a repair in under one hour, the repair being carried out under normal circumstances - i.e. drive to customer and perform repair out of a van on their driveway. The repair should be similar to either of the two pictured on the standard ABC leaflet which has the bold red stamp stating "Back to perfection in less than an hour" on top of them. We'll only start timing from when he arrives at the customer's premises.


 


2 - Smart to present to us just 10 franchisees (they have 90) who have been trading for over a year and have achieved the advertised typical earnings of £90,000.


 


3 - Smart to explain their continuing adverts such as "All our Franchisees earn between £1000 and £2000 during their first week and are reporting consistent continual growth - FACT!". How can this possibly be "Fact" when over 30 have had to cease trading and many more are struggling?


 


4 - Smart to explain why they indicated they were BFA members when they were not. Also please explain why you are still not full or even affiliate BFA members. Also please explain the VBRA debacle where you had franchisee's handing out unauthorised leaflets.


 


The list goes on, but that will do to start. feel free to add other agenda items you would like to be considered below.

[10/06/2010] Bob: Something tells me Jeff and Martin may not be all they seem. £600 per day???? Even at an average of £100 this is 6 jobs per day, if doing retail this is impossible even is you could do the repair in 1 1/2 hours this is a total of 9 hours, plus travelling in between/setting up ect. It is posssible to do this at 1 trade site, however, trade prices you are looking at around £65-£70 this is close on 9 jobs per day!!!
In addition, if you can book in 6 jobs per day (30 per week) your phone must be ringing off the hook as not every enquirery will book in. As for smart ABC having great products, why do they rely on a piece of kit designed to match colours on leather rather than just going off the 100% accurite paint code

[10/06/2010] Bob: Grafter, I stand corrected on the spectrometer point, however, I still dont see why Smart ABC need to sell a £4 500 piece of kit which is by its nature open to mismatches, why not just use the paint code on the vehicle, which is 99.9% accurite


[10/06/2010] Grafter: Because paint codes arent always accurate!

Often there are 4 or 5 different shades to anyone code, and pick the wrong one, and your in trouble!!!

I can only comment on my own experiece, but so far (touch wood), I've not had any problems with it.

And, if nothing else, it works as a great selling tool when talking to customers - I've one over a number of customers on the basis that i can demonstrate that I use, (what i honestly believe to be) the most advanced system on the market.

[29/08/2010] gerry lawson: well, having had a smart abc franchise for 8 months and managed to sell it on and not loose any money i am the lucky one ammongst many. i would like to tell everyone out there how i see it.
i am 50 years old and very savvy to worldly stuff and i was taken in by nick and his team of smiling yes men, i have over 30 years of vehicle bodywork and paint work experience to call upon so doing the work was the easy bit for me, it now transpires that nick and his team (mainly family now) are out to rip people off left right and centre, they have people from all aspects of life who simply want to do something they enjoy and make money at the same time. i have to say that the concept and the system works well and if adhered to is very very repeatable. what s a shame is all the lies i and everyone else was told during our individual open days, you cannot do a paint repair in under an hour in the field, it is extremely hard to manage three repairs per day, it is even harder to earn over 1000 pounds a week which is the minimum you need to earn to pay your over heads, the van is too expensive, the insurance is a rip off etc etc. it is very clear to me that they never had any intention of giving their franchisees any help or backing after the totally inadaquate three weeks training, and now they have reduced the cost of the franchise by half! they are now taking the piss. if i were still trading as smart abc i would be having a very quiet chat with nick bicknell if you know what i mean.
DO NOT CONSIDER THIS FRANCHISE
ps : the guy i sold my business to has now ceased trading with massive depts and has signed back into the navy to earn some money so he doesnt loose his house and to pay his depts back. the guy in llenelli did it right he has no assets to loose they cant have what you havent got can they.
